What to expect from this ‘insights focused’ course
The course is aligned with The Profession Map's eight core behaviours. Learn more about these behaviours here.
You’ll explore your role in developing insights and then focus on creating solutions based on these insights. You’ll learn how to ask the right questions, determine the quality and relevance of evidence and identify the cause of a situation so you can make evidence-based decisions.
What you’ll need to do on this course
This course has six lessons, which you can access online at a time that suits you. You can work through the lessons at your own pace and in the order you choose. Each lesson is 30-45 minutes long and includes reflective and community activities to help you embed your learning.

Learning outcomes
By the end of this ‘insights focused’ course, you’ll be able to:
- take a disciplined and open-minded approach to understanding and defining organisational issues and their root causes
- acquire multiple sources of evidence to test assumptions and ideas
- analyse and evaluate evidence to create insight and identify sources of bias
- develop and improve the quality of ideas and proposals
- review evidence and ideas to identify themes and connections and gain insight into the issue and its broader implications.
